Output 123fc8cabd42ae5fd02654b5116ececfb85e43ef7cb4d19ecf94d4d5c3c8f103:0

value
100000000
script pubkey
OP_0 OP_PUSHBYTES_20 cc440ddd8bb2dc16d92d32e504fbe738a6c88951
address
bc1qe3zqmhvtktwpdkfdxtjsf7l88znv3z23carwrq
transaction
123fc8cabd42ae5fd02654b5116ececfb85e43ef7cb4d19ecf94d4d5c3c8f103
confirmations
18125
spent
true